Maple für Professional
Maple für Akademiker
Maple für Studenten
Maple Personal Edition
Maple Player
Maple Player für iPad
MapleSim für Professional
MapleSim für Akademiker
Maple T.A. - Testen & beurteilen
Maple T.A. MAA Placement Test Suite
Möbius - Online-Courseware
Machine Design / Industrial Automation
Luft- und Raumfahrt
Fahrzeugtechnik
Robotics
Energiebranche
System Simulation and Analysis
Model development for HIL
Anlagenmodelle für den Regelungsentwurf
Robotics/Motion Control/Mechatronics
Other Application Areas
Mathematikausbildung
Technik
Allgemein- und berufsbildende Schulen
Testen und beurteilen
Studierende
Finanzmodelle
Betriebsforschung
Hochleistungsrechnen
Physik
Live-Webinare
Aufgezeichnete Webinare
Geplante Veranstaltungen
MaplePrimes
Maplesoft-Blog
Maplesoft-Mitgliedschaft
Maple Ambassador Program
MapleCloud
Technische Whitepapers
E-Mail Newsletters
Maple-Bücher
Math Matters
Anwendungs-Center
MapleSim Modell-Galerie
Anwenderberichte
Exploring Engineering Fundamentals
Lehrkonzepte mit Maple
Maplesoft Welcome-Center
Resource-Center für Lehrer
Help-Center für Studierende
VectorCalculus[AddCoordinates] - 新しい座標系の追加
使い方
AddCoordinates(newsys, eqns, owrite)
パラメータ
newsys - 記号[名前, 名前, ...]; 新しい座標の名前を添えた、新しい座標系の名前の指定
eqns - リスト(代数式); 新しい座標系をデカルト座標に関連付ける数式の指定
owrite - (オプション) identical('overwrite')=truefalse の形の等式; 座標テーブル内にある既存の座標系を上書きするかどうかの指定
説明
AddCoordinates(newsys, eqns, owrite) コマンドは、VectorCalculus パッケージに新しい直交曲線座標系を追加します。この新しい座標系は、他の組み込み座標系と同じ方法で、使用することが可能です。
3 つめのオプション引数 owrite を指定する場合、その指定は、overwrite という名前か、または identical('overwrite')=truefalse という型の等式でなくてはなりません。デフォルトは、'overwrite'=false です。
newsys と同じ名前の座標系が既に存在している場合には、owrite パラメータがその古い座標系を上書きするかどうかを決定します。古い座標系に上書きを行わない場合には、エラーが起こります。
AddCoordinates を呼び出す前に、変数に仮定を配置するか、または assuming キーワードを使用してください。これは、新しい系でとり得る座標値として認識される、多くの情報を計算するする際に手助けとなります。
例
with(VectorCalculus):
Warning, the assigned names <,> and <|> now have a global binding Warning, these protected names have been redefined and unprotected: *, +, ., Vector, diff, int, limit, series
assume(r>0,0<=theta,theta<2*Pi); AddCoordinates( 'mypolar'[r,theta], [r*cos(theta),r*sin(theta)] );
Laplacian( f(r,theta), 'mypolar'[r,theta] );
assume(u>=0,v>=0); AddCoordinates( 'foo'[u,v], [u^2+v^2,u^2-v^2] );
F := VectorField( <f(u,v),g(u,v)>, 'foo'[u,v] );
Divergence( F );
参照
仮定機能, assuming, VectorCalculus パッケージの紹介, VectorCalculus[Divergence], VectorCalculus[GetCoordinates], VectorCalculus[Laplacian], VectorCalculus[SetCoordinates], VectorCalculus[VectorField]
Download Help Document